Output fc76734cdd591915e23f325639e3560d90c47dd07164d4b59e1bfd2a371a2481:0

value
18403498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3064cc14296198352dd392788a3c31b993ee5568 OP_EQUAL
address
MCK3R9bkYyx9Sgi5ToBvzSQFXv1wyz18dS
transaction
fc76734cdd591915e23f325639e3560d90c47dd07164d4b59e1bfd2a371a2481
spent
true